Abstract

The invention discloses a traditional Chinese medicine composition for ascending the clear and descending the turbid, which comprises the following components in parts by weight: 2 parts of radix bupleuri, 2 parts of rhizoma cimicifugae, 3 parts of radix astragali, 2 parts of lotus leaf, 1 part of cassia twig, 2 parts of fructus aurantii, 2 parts of rhizoma coptidis, 2 parts of rhizoma atractylodis macrocephalae, 2 parts of poria cocos, 1 part of ginseng, 1 part of liquorice, 1 part of starch and 3 parts of agar; the prescription treats the diarrhea caused by dysfunction of spleen and stomach and invasion of pathogenic factors, and the principle of treating the diarrhea is as follows: by ascending the clear and descending the turbid, namely, the spleen should ascend and the stomach should descend, the compatibility of the cassia twig and the coptis in the formula is favorable for improving the intestinal function, the cassia twig warms the channel and dredges the collaterals, the congestion and the edema of intestinal mucosa can be reduced, and the coptis clears away heat, promotes diuresis and stops diarrhea; cimicifugae rhizoma, bupleuri radix, and folium Nelumbinis have the effects of invigorating qi, fructus Aurantii is used for removing filth of gastrointestinal foul qi, and radix Ginseng, Atractylodis rhizoma, Poria, Glycyrrhrizae radix, and radix astragali with effects of invigorating spleen, replenishing qi and invigorating spleen are added.

Background
The diarrhea disease is a digestive tract disease which is caused by various pathogens and various factors and has the characteristics of increasing stool frequency and changing stool characters, the common treatment mode adopted by western medicine is to supplement water to prevent dehydration, and simultaneously montmorillonite powder is matched for treatment, although the corresponding treatment mode is required for diarrhea caused by special conditions, the situation is not in the discussion range of the application, the montmorillonite is a silicate body, crystals are in a layered structure, and like waffles which are frequently eaten by people, the montmorillonite has a huge surface area, 3g of montmorillonite can cover the whole gastrointestinal wall of normal adults, and can last for more than 6 hours, and the common dosage of the adults is as follows: 3g each time, 3 times a day, in addition, the montmorillonite also has uneven charge distribution, can absorb, fix and inhibit charged viruses, particularly rotavirus germs, escherichia coli, vibrio cholerae, helicobacter pylori and mould, and toxin adsorption generated by the viruses, and the montmorillonite powder also has a covering effect on the mucous membrane of the digestive tract, a layer of protective screen is manufactured for the digestive tract of people, and the defense capability of the digestive tract to attack factors is greatly improved, so that the antidiarrheal effect is exerted.
The traditional Chinese medicine for treating diarrhea is mainly characterized in that: the traditional Chinese medicine has the main effects of clearing heat and promoting diuresis, strengthening spleen and replenishing qi, warming middle-jiao and dispelling cold, warming kidney and dispelling cold, relieving diarrhea with astringents and the like, and can achieve a certain treatment effect, but the applicant finds in practice that the illness state treated by the treatment method is easy to repeat, and the traditional Chinese medicine theory considers that: the stomach governs accepting rotten food, and the spleen governs transporting and resolving water dampness and absorbing food essence, so that the ascending and descending functions of the spleen and stomach cannot be influenced: the stomach is descending and the spleen is ascending. If the spleen and stomach are affected by diseases, the spleen and stomach are disadvantaged in ascending, descending, transformation and absorption, so that after the food enters the stomach, food is not transformed, essence cannot be absorbed, turbid and clear are not separated, and diarrhea is caused by combined dirt, and the reason why the diarrhea is repeated is that: the dysfunction of spleen and stomach in ascending and descending is not treated, and the function is not radically recovered, for example, the Chinese book entitled "Su Wen Bing Ji Yi Bao Ming Ji" discloses a peony decoction, which comprises the following specific components: the formula is one of the commonly used clinical formulas, but after the formula is used, the formula has a good antidiarrheal effect, but the disease condition is easy to repeat.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a traditional Chinese medicine composition for ascending the clear, descending the turbid and benefiting the spleen, which is used for solving the acute and chronic diarrhea and the acute gastritis caused by dysfunction of the spleen and the stomach, and can simultaneously play a role in oral administration and external application to fully play the efficacy.
In order to achieve the purpose, the invention adopts the following technical scheme:
a traditional Chinese medicine composition for ascending the clear, descending the turbid and benefiting the spleen is composed of the following components in parts by weight: 2 parts of radix bupleuri, 2 parts of rhizoma cimicifugae, 3 parts of radix astragali, 2 parts of lotus leaf, 1 part of cassia twig, 2 parts of fructus aurantii, 2 parts of rhizoma coptidis, 2 parts of rhizoma atractylodis macrocephalae, 2 parts of poria cocos, 1 part of ginseng and 1 part of liquorice.
Further, still include: 1 part of starch and 3 parts of agar.
Further, crushing the medicinal materials by a crusher, putting the crushed medicinal materials into a decocting vessel, decocting for a plurality of hours, filtering out dregs of a decoction to obtain a decoction, and directly taking the decoction orally.
Further, crushing the above medicinal materials with a pulverizer, decocting in a decocting vessel for several hours, filtering to remove residues to obtain decoction, and cooling at 0-8 deg.C to obtain jelly.
The invention has at least the following beneficial effects:
(1) treats both principal and secondary aspects of diseases, breaks through the limitation of the traditional treatment, and has the function of promoting the recovery of intestinal functions while treating diarrhea by selecting medicines.
(2) Ascending the clear and descending the turbid, invigorating the spleen to arrest diarrhea, fundamentally solving the problem of diarrhea by adjusting the dysfunction of viscera, and breaking through the traditional method of mainly arresting diarrhea.
(3) The preparation can be taken orally and also used for external application, and the starch and agar powder in the preparation can improve the viscosity and the adhesive force of the preparation when being applied externally, and can effectively contact with the skin to exert the drug property.

Examples
The traditional Chinese medicine composition comprises the following components in parts by weight: 2 parts of radix bupleuri, 2 parts of rhizoma cimicifugae, 3 parts of radix astragali, 2 parts of lotus leaf, 1 part of cassia twig, 2 parts of fructus aurantii, 2 parts of rhizoma coptidis, 2 parts of rhizoma atractylodis macrocephalae, 2 parts of poria cocos, 1 part of ginseng, 1 part of liquorice, 1 part of starch and 3 parts of agar;
the usage and dosage are as follows: in the example, one part by weight represents 5g, three times a day, one dose is given at a time, and the obtained liquid medicine is divided into two parts, one part is taken orally, and the other part is taken externally.
The prescription treats the diarrhea caused by dysfunction of spleen and stomach and invasion of pathogenic factors, and the principle of treating the diarrhea is as follows: by ascending the clear and descending the turbid, namely, the spleen should ascend and the stomach should descend, the compatibility of the cassia twig and the coptis in the formula is favorable for improving the intestinal function, the cassia twig warms the channel and dredges the collaterals, the congestion and the edema of intestinal mucosa can be reduced, and the coptis clears away heat, promotes diuresis and stops diarrhea; cimicifugae rhizoma, bupleuri radix, and folium Nelumbinis have the effects of invigorating qi, fructus Aurantii is used for removing filth of gastrointestinal foul qi, and radix Ginseng, Atractylodis rhizoma, Poria, Glycyrrhrizae radix, and radix astragali with effects of invigorating spleen, replenishing qi and invigorating spleen are added.
More importantly: the formula of the embodiment can be used as an external medicine under the condition of not changing the formula of the formula even though the formula is used for oral administration, and the oral administration and the external application are usually carried out simultaneously when the formula is used, so that a better using effect can be achieved.
The decoction method of the oral medicine is the same as the prior art, namely the medicinal materials are crushed by a crusher and then put into a decoction vessel for decocting for several hours, and dregs of a decoction are filtered to obtain decoction which is taken at 20-30 ℃; when the solid medicament is used as an external medicament, the solid medicament is easier to lay compared with the traditional medicament, the traditional medicament for soup can be dried after several hours, the acting time is short, the gel medicament has more water stored in the gel, the liquid medicament can exert the drug effect for a longer time, and the two coagulants can be eaten by themselves, so the external medicament for soup and the internal medicament for soup are simultaneously used for external application and internal administration, the decoction is used at the same time without separate preparation, and the combined use of the two can achieve better use effect, thereby further consolidating the curative effect.
